Research On Collaborative Techniques For Automobile Logistics Service Value Chain Based On Cloud Platform

With the development of the automobile industry and the rising share of the logistics outsourcing, the automobile industry asked for higher requirements on the logistics services. The automobile industry was no longer just concerned about the basic content of logistics services in punctuality or integrity, but also more attention to the profession, integration, coordination, process monitoring and so on. The collaborative model of logistics service value chain also will be developed from from the point chain collaboration model centred on manufacturing enterprises and the line chain collaboration model centred on logistics enterprises to the chain-wide collaborative mode. The chain-wide collaborative mode of logistics service value chain must have a logistic cloud service platform to support, so as to enable enterprises to have a collaborative conditions and power, and make enterprises to obtain faster market responsiveness and greater market competitiveness. But the construction of logistics service platform requires the collaborative technology of value chain to support the platform and business collaboration. So, research on collaborative techniques for automobile logistics service value chain based on cloud platform has great significance for the coordination of automobile logistics service value chain.Based on the National 863 project’research and development of collaborative services platform’and the national science & technology pillar program’research on the whole supply chain coordination and the third party logistics service technology’, took automobile manufacturing enterprises and logistics service enterprises as the research subject, the logistics service value chain collaboration model based on logistics cloud services platform was discussed, a overall solution for the coordination of automobile logistics service value chain was proposed, the technology of cooperative organization, collaborative strategy and cooperative rule based on logistics cloud services platform were researched. The dissertation specifically included the following points:(1) The collaborative mode and overall solution of automotive logistics service value chain based on cloud platform.The connotation of logistics service, the contents of China’s automobile logistics service, the development of China’s automobile logistics service mode, and the concept, features and classification of automobile logistics service value chain was introduced. By analyzed the cooperation mode of automobile manufacturing enterprises, the cooperation mode of small and medium logistics service enterprises, the cooperative mode and cooperative effect of the automobile logistics value chain based on Logistic cloud service platform was researched, a overall solution for the coordination of automobile logistics service value chain was proposed, the competition mechanism of cooperative organization, cooperation mechanism of collaborative strategy, cooperation mechanism of cooperative rules was designed.(2) The collaborative organization of automobile logistics service value chain based on cloud platform.By analyzed the collaborative organization of automobile logistics service value chain based on cloud platform, the collaborative organized preferred model which around ’established index system, data processed, determined index weight calculation, comprehensive evaluation, performance prediction’was established, Logistics enterprises evaluation model by TOPSIS and short-term logistics service performance prediction method were researched. The logistics enterprises evaluation model used a combination of qualitative and quantitative methods, obtained the objective weight of index by fuzzy rough set, defined the subjective weight of index by expert scoring method, then integrated the subjective and objective weights, used the comprehensive weights in TOPSIS to evaluation. The short-term logistics service performance prediction method was based on the comprehensive assessment results and historical task volume, used the time sequence forecast method based on weighted moving average technology, provided effective reference for enterprises to build the collaborative organization.(3) The collaborative strategy of the automobile logistics service value chain based on cloud platform.The automobile logistics service value chain collaborative transport strategy and collaborative loading and unloading strategy based on cloud platform was researched. The collaborative service resource integration model was build for the collaborative transport strategy, integrated logistics service resources by logistics cloud services platform, based on automobile parts logistics constraints, the logistics collaborative transportation strategy model driven by distribution profit was build, so as to promoted the value chain of logistics service and the win-win of the enterprises. The collaborative loading and unloading strategy with multi types of goods, multi unloading points and multi car carriers was researched. The multi-unloading van packing problem model was established, to solve the optimal collaborative loading and unloading strategy by single pheromone ant colony algorithm and multi pheromone ant colony algorithm. A reasonable collaborative loading and unloading strategy could make logistics service enterprises to save transportation vehicles and services cost.(4) The collaborative rules of the automobile logistics service value chain based on cloud platform.The cooperative benefit allocation rule model of the automobile logistics service value chain based on cloud platform was established. The cooperative profit distribution model for logistics service providers and demanders was researched. Four factors affecting logistics cooperative profit distribution were defined in the cooperative profit distribution model for logistics service demanders, the profit distribution model with an improved correction factor Shapley value was established.In the process of cooperative profit distribute for logistics service providers, the collaborative logistics profit distribution model based on agent was established, obtained the satisfactory results for all parties to ensure the smooth and continuous development of logistics cooperation.(5) The development and implement of cloud service platform for automobile logistics services value chain collaboration.The logistics cloud service platform for vehicle logistics business based on business requirements of the transport vehicle logistics was developed. According to the actual needs of enterprises, we used logistic service enterprises evaluation method, logistics vehicle collaborative transportation method and profit distribution method in different logistics cloud platform services businesses. According to the requirements of data integration on cloud platform, a configurable data integration scheme was designed, the data integration system adapter was developed and applied in the cloud platform. According to the personalized tracking requirements of logistics enterprises, two kinds of positioning scheme: Intelligent mobile terminal and base station were researched, the logistics tracking system based on two positioning scheme was developed. At last, the logistics cloud service platform’s extension and application in enterprises was introduced.
